JOB DESCRIPTION
Iron EagleX is seeking a skilled Systems Engineer Senior Principal to join our dynamic team at Fort Bragg in Fayetteville, NC. The ideal candidate will be responsible for managing and maintaining Linux-based systems, ensuring optimal performance, security, and compliance with Authorization to Operate (ATO) standards. This role involves overseeing Amazon Web Services (AWS) infrastructure, data management, and implementing robust network security measures to support analytics and data science tool adoption. This is a hybrid position at Fort Bragg (3 days onsite, 2 days remote).
Job Duties Include (but not limited to):
- System Administration: Install, configure, and maintain Linux servers to ensure stability, performance, and security.
- AWS Management: Oversee AWS infrastructure, including provisioning, monitoring, and scaling resources as needed.
- Data Management: Implement and manage data storage solutions, ensuring data integrity, availability, and security.
- Network Security: Develop and enforce security policies, monitor for vulnerabilities, and respond promptly to security incidents.
- ATO Compliance: Ensure systems adhere to ATO standards, including maintaining documentation, conducting regular audits and overseeing submission of ATO renewal packages
- Automation: Utilize scripting and automation tools to streamline system management tasks and improve operational efficiency.
- Monitoring and Maintenance: Regularly monitor system performance, apply updates, and perform routine maintenance to ensure optimal operation.
